What You'll Do Work 1:1 with clients in their home, school, or community setting. Implement individualized ABA programs designed by a BCBA. Collect and record session data using easy-to-use technology. Collaborate with your BCBA and receive regular supervision. Support clients in developing communication, social, and daily living skills.
